First off, having a water hose nozzle with a built - in filter can be a game - changer. You see, water from our hoses might contain all sorts of debris like sand, small rocks, or even rust particles. These can not only clog up your nozzle but also cause damage to the internal parts over time. A built - in filter acts as a shield, preventing these unwanted particles from getting into the nozzle and ruining its performance.

So, how do these filters work? Well, it's pretty simple. When water enters the nozzle, it first passes through the filter. The filter has tiny holes or pores that are small enough to stop debris but large enough to let water flow through. The trapped debris then stays in the filter, and you can easily clean it out from time to time. Most of the filters are removable, which makes maintenance a breeze. You just need to take out the filter, rinse it under running water, and put it back in.
One of the big advantages of having a built - in filter is the longevity of your nozzle. Without a filter, debris can build up inside the nozzle, causing wear and tear on the internal components. This can lead to leaks, reduced water pressure, and eventually, the need to replace the nozzle. But with a filter, you can extend the life of your nozzle significantly. You'll save money in the long run by not having to buy new nozzles as often.
Another benefit is the quality of the water spray. A clogged nozzle can result in a weak or uneven spray, which can be frustrating, especially when you're trying to water your plants evenly. The filter ensures that the water coming out of the nozzle is clean and free of debris, giving you a consistent and powerful spray every time.
